Key Principles and Provisions of the Outer Space Treaty
The key principles and provisions of the Outer Space Treaty establish the framework for responsible space activities. Central to this treaty are several fundamental concepts that promote international cooperation and peaceful use of outer space.
One primary principle is that outer space shall be utilized for the benefit of all countries, emphasizing the importance of non-appropriation. The treaty explicitly prohibits national claims of sovereignty over celestial bodies, ensuring space remains a global commons. It also mandates that states retain jurisdiction over their space activities, whether conducted by government or private entities.
The treaty emphasizes that space activities must avoid harmful contamination and must comply with international standards. It further obligates parties to avoid weapons of mass destruction in space and promotes the peaceful resolution of disputes. These provisions aim to foster cooperation while maintaining the safety and sustainability of outer space activities.
In summary, the treaty’s key principles include non-appropriation, international cooperation, responsible use, and peaceful purposes. These provisions form the foundation for subsequent space law development and regulation.

Challenges and Limitations of the Outer Space Treaty
The Outer Space Treaty faces several challenges that limit its effectiveness in governing space activities. One primary issue is the lack of binding enforcement mechanisms, making it difficult to ensure compliance by all nations. Without enforceable sanctions, some states may disregard treaty provisions.
Another challenge stems from the rapid advancement of space technology and commercial activity, which outpaces existing legal frameworks. This creates ambiguity over jurisdiction and responsibility, especially involving private companies and non-signatory states.
Furthermore, the treaty’s scope is limited regarding resource utilization, such as asteroid mining and space property rights. These gaps raise questions about ownership and usage rights, which are not explicitly addressed within the treaty’s provisions.
Finally, the treaty’s reliance on voluntary adherence leaves loopholes that some nations might exploit. As new actors enter space, the treaty’s ability to maintain peaceful cooperation and prevent militarization becomes increasingly uncertain.
Other International Agreements Related to Space Law
Beyond the Outer Space Treaty, several other international agreements further shape space law. These treaties address specific issues such as the rescue of astronauts, liability for damage caused by space activities, and the registration of space objects. The Rescue Agreement, for instance, outlines the obligations of states to assist astronauts in distress and return them safely to their home countries. The Liability Convention establishes that launching states are liable for damages caused by their space activities, emphasizing accountability in space operations.
The Registration Convention requires states to maintain and share information about space objects launched into orbit to promote transparency and responsibility. These agreements complement the Outer Space Treaty by elaborating on its principles and creating a comprehensive legal framework for space activities. While they have been widely adopted, challenges remain in enforcing compliance and addressing emerging issues like space resource utilization. Collectively, these agreements form the backbone of international space law, ensuring responsible and cooperative exploration beyond Earth.

Space Resource Utilization and Private Property Rights
The Outer Space Treaty acknowledges that celestial bodies and space resources are not subject to national appropriation by sovereignty, but it does not explicitly address private property rights over space resources. This ambiguity presents challenges as private companies increasingly explore resource utilization.
Current international law emphasizes the use of space resources for the benefit of all humankind, but it remains unclear how private entities can claim ownership or exploit resources like lunar minerals or asteroid materials. The treaty’s language suggests that space is a global commons, limiting individual ownership claims.
However, developments such as the U.S. Commercial Space Launch Competitiveness Act of 2015 have begun to define property rights related to space resources within national jurisdictions. These laws permit private companies to own resources they extract, but they raise questions about consistency with the Outer Space Treaty’s principles.
As private entities pursue commercial space resource utilization, the legal framework may need further clarification to balance innovation, private property rights, and international obligations. This ongoing debate underlines the importance of developing comprehensive space law to regulate private activities responsibly.

Case Studies of National Space Regulations
Several nations have developed national space regulations to complement the Outer Space Treaty and address specific legal and operational challenges. For example, the United States’ Commercial Space Launch Act of 1984 establishes licensing procedures for private space activities, ensuring safety and liability compliance. Similarly, Luxembourg’s space resources law of 2017 explicitly grants private entities rights over extraterrestrial minerals, reflecting its proactive approach to space resource utilization.
In contrast, India’s space regulations, managed by the Indian Space Research Organisation (ISRO), emphasize government oversight and national security considerations while promoting commercial participation. These regulations ensure coordination with international treaties, particularly regarding space debris management and responsible use of outer space.
Overall, these case studies illustrate how national regulations adapt international principles to local legal environments and policy objectives. They also highlight the varying approaches countries take to enforce responsible space conduct, balancing innovation with compliance under the broader framework of space law.
